Silicon Valley Research Group Inc. Conducts eSurvey™ Research for Leading Broadband IC Provider

Design managers and engineers invited to participate in web-based survey to assess corporate brand equity.

Seattle, WA - May 31, 2001 - Silicon Valley Research Group Inc. (www.siliconvalleyrg.com), a leading high technology research and strategy development company, has been commissioned by PMC-Sierra, a leading broadband IC provider, to conduct a study using Silicon Valley Research Group Inc. eSurvey™ to measure brand awareness and equity. eSurvey™ is a quantitative research survey conducted for the purpose of obtaining empirical evaluations of attitudes, behavior or performance. Qualified respondents are invited via email to participate in the web-based survey. After participants complete the survey and submit their response, their answers are instantly transferred to a statistical software program for frequency and cross-tabulation calculations. Selective participants, representing design managers and engineers, will be invited to complete the web-based survey designed to trap top-of-mind awareness for the PMC-Sierra brand and product lines. “Our eSurvey™ service will provide our client with the ability to measure their awareness amongst their customers and target market,” says Al Nazarelli, President and Founder of Silicon Valley Research Group Inc. “This information is invaluable to companies as they evaluate the success of their own marketing initiatives and plan for future awareness campaigns.” PMC-Sierra plans to continue their brand building initiatives upon the completion of the study.
